MAX16930BATLS/V+T Description
The MAX16930BATLS/V+T is a high-performance, dual synchronous buck controller with preboost functionality, designed for demanding automotive applications. This device, manufactured by Analog Devices Inc./Maxim Integrated, offers a wide input voltage range of 3.5V to 42V, making it suitable for various power management scenarios. The controller supports switching frequencies from 1MHz to 2.2MHz, enabling efficient power conversion and minimizing electromagnetic interference (EMI). The MAX16930BATLS/V+T is housed in a surface-mount package, specifically in a tape and reel format, which facilitates automated assembly processes.
MAX16930BATLS/V+T Features
- Output Type: Transistor Driver
- Output Configuration: Positive
- Frequency - Switching: 1MHz to 2.2MHz
- Voltage - Supply (Vcc/Vdd): 3.5V to 42V
- Synchronous Rectifier: Yes
- Control Features: Enable, Frequency Control, Power Good
- Duty Cycle (Max): 95%
- Output Phases: 2
- Clock Sync: Yes
- Number of Outputs: 3
- Moisture Sensitivity Level (MSL): 1 (Unlimited)
- REACH Status: REACH Unaffected
- RoHS Status: ROHS3 Compliant
- ECCN: EAR99
- HTSUS: 8542.39.0001
- Grade: Automotive
- Topology: Buck, Boost
- Mounting Type: Surface Mount
- Package: Tape & Reel (TR)
The MAX16930BATLS/V+T stands out with its dual buck topology, which includes a preboost stage to ensure stable operation even under low input voltage conditions. This feature is particularly beneficial in automotive environments where voltage fluctuations are common. The device's ability to synchronize clocks ensures clean power delivery and reduces noise, enhancing overall system performance.
MAX16930BATLS/V+T Applications
The MAX16930BATLS/V+T is ideal for automotive applications that require robust power management solutions. Its wide input voltage range and dual buck topology make it suitable for powering electronic control units (ECUs), infotainment systems, and advanced driver-assistance systems (ADAS). The preboost functionality ensures reliable operation in scenarios with variable input voltages, such as during engine start-up or when using alternative energy sources.
Specific use cases include:
- Automotive ECUs: Providing stable power to critical control units.
- Infotainment Systems: Ensuring reliable power supply to multimedia systems.
- ADAS: Supporting advanced safety features by delivering consistent power.
